예제 #1
0
파일: test_app.py 프로젝트: szabgab/slides
def test_new_year(monkeypatch):
    mydt = datetime.datetime

    class MyDatetime():
        def now():
            return mydt(2000, 1, 1)

    monkeypatch.setattr(app.datetime, 'datetime', MyDatetime)
    task_name = app.daily_task()
    print(task_name)
    assert task_name == 'new_year'
예제 #2
0
파일: test_app.py 프로젝트: szabgab/slides
def test_leap_year(monkeypatch):
    mydt = datetime.datetime

    class MyDatetime():
        def now():
            return mydt(2004, 2, 29)

    monkeypatch.setattr(app.datetime, 'datetime', MyDatetime)
    task_name = app.daily_task()
    print(task_name)
    assert task_name == 'leap_day'
예제 #3
0
파일: test_app.py 프로젝트: szabgab/slides
def test_today(monkeypatch):
    mydt = datetime.datetime

    class MyDatetime():
        def now():
            return mydt(2004, 2, 28)

    monkeypatch.setattr(app.datetime, 'datetime', MyDatetime)
    task_name = app.daily_task()
    print(task_name)
    assert task_name == 'regular'
예제 #4
0
파일: use_app.py 프로젝트: szabgab/slides
import app

task_name = app.daily_task()
print(task_name)
예제 #5
0
def test_today():
    task_name = app.daily_task()
    print(task_name)
    assert task_name == 'regular'